Midtown Gainesville, Gainesville, FL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Midtown Gainesville?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Midtown Gainesville | $1,408 | $849 | $3,236 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Midtown Gainesville | $1,351 | $899 | $5,099 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Midtown Gainesville | $1,262 | $725 | $6,186 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Midtown Gainesville | $1,281 | $615 | $8,204 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Midtown Gainesville | $987 | $625 | $7,320 |
